This is a World War II photo identification badge for a Watertown Arsenal employee (Watertown, Massachusetts.) Watertown Arsenal, now on the American Society of Civil Engineers' list of historic landmarks, was used by the United States Army from 1816 until 196The badge is numbered 1151 and shows a photo of employee Salvatore Mandile.
